 Funke Akindele Sparks Backlash Over Birthday Photos Amid Nollywood Mourning for Ogogo Nollywood superstar Funke Akindele has found herself at the center of social media criticism following her decision to share glamorous birthday photos on Monday, August 24. The actress, who celebrated her 49th birthday, posted celebratory images and expressed heartfelt gratitude to God just as the Nigerian film industry was reeling from the tragic news of veteran actor Taiwo Hassan’s passing. Taiwo Hassan, widely known as Ogogo, was a beloved figure in Yoruba cinema, and his death has cast a somber shadow over Nollywood. While Akindele had previously shared a message of condolence, many fans felt her subsequent festive posts were poorly timed, sparking a heated debate about empathy and social media etiquette during times of grief.
